Hinton’s productive fourth inning secures win over Wolverines
Only once did Hinton post a crooked number on the scoreboard, but that was more than enough. The Blackhawks enjoyed a four-run fourth inning on the way to a 7-1 War Eagle Conference victory over South O’Brien June 12 at Hinton.
Pitcher Ben Woodall went the distance for the Wolverines, allowing 10 hits. The seven Hinton runs were all earned. Woodall struck out two batters, walked three and hit three.
Trevor Fiddelke singled and scored the South O’Brien run. Woodall also had a single and Dain Moermond recorded a double. In addition, Gabe Moermond drew a walk and Ryan Fuller was hit by a pitch.
